Navigating Family Law In Dalton, Ga: Finding The Right Attorney

Finding a Divorce Lawyer in Dalton, Cowan Law Office from cowanlawoffice.com

When it comes to family law, it’s important to find an attorney who is familiar with the laws and regulations of Dalton, Georgia. Family law covers a wide range of issues, including divorce, child custody, property division, alimony, and more. Whether you’re facing a divorce or another family law issue, it’s important to find a knowledgeable attorney to guide you through the process.

The right family law attorney in Dalton, GA can help you navigate this complex process. An experienced attorney will be familiar with the nuances of family law and can ensure that your rights and interests are protected. To help you find an attorney who’s right for you, here are some tips to consider.

1. Ask for Recommendations

One of the best ways to find a qualified family law attorney is to ask for recommendations from friends and family members who have gone through similar situations. Ask for details about their experiences, including how well the attorney handled their case. This can help you get a better idea of the type of attorney you’re looking for.

2. Do Your Research

Once you have a list of potential attorneys, start researching them. Visit their website and read their biographies to get an understanding of their background and experience. You can also read reviews from past clients to get a better sense of how they handle cases. It’s important to find an attorney who is knowledgeable and experienced with the laws and regulations of Dalton, GA.

3. Make a List of Questions

When you’re meeting with potential attorneys, it’s important to have a list of questions ready. Ask about their experience in family law, their approach to cases, and any other questions you may have. This will help you get a better idea of how the attorney works and if they’re the right fit for your case.

4. Ask for Referrals

When you’re interviewing potential attorneys, ask for referrals from other attorneys, clients, and even judges. This will help you get a better sense of the attorney’s experience and reputation. It’s also a good idea to ask for referrals from former clients to get a better understanding of how the attorney handled their case.

5. Consider Fees

Cost is an important factor to consider when selecting a family law attorney. Ask about their fees and payment plans to ensure that you’re comfortable with the payment arrangement. It’s also important to find out if the attorney offers a free initial consultation.

6. Schedule an Initial Consultation

Once you’ve narrowed down your list of potential attorneys, schedule an initial consultation. This is an important step to get to know the attorney and get a better understanding of their approach to cases. During the consultation, discuss your situation and ask any questions you may have.

7. Make Your Decision

After you’ve met with potential attorneys, it’s time to make a decision. Choose an attorney who is knowledgeable, experienced, and a good fit for your situation. Once you’ve chosen an attorney, be sure to discuss all the details and fees before signing a contract.

Conclusion

Navigating family law in Dalton, GA can be a difficult and confusing process. It’s important to find an experienced attorney who is familiar with the laws and regulations in Dalton. By following these tips, you can find an attorney who is a good fit for your situation and can help you through the process.
